Understanding the Mechanics of the Chicken Road

At its heart, a ‘chicken road’ game usually presents a path comprised of steps or stages. With each step taken, the potential multiplier—and therefore the potential winnings—increases. However, at any point, a hazard can appear, causing the game to end and the player to lose their accumulated earnings. The art lies in predicting when the risk of encountering a hazard outweighs the potential reward. Successful players are adept at reading virtual cues, often subtle indicators meant to signal impending danger and smartly choose to cash out before reaching a dead end.

The psychological aspect of the game is, perhaps, its most intriguing element. The desire to push for an even higher multiplier often clashes with the fear of losing everything. This internal conflict provides a unique form of entertainment, engaging players on a level beyond mere luck. Responsible Gaming and Setting Limits

Like all forms of gambling, ‘chicken road’ games carry the potential for addiction and financial harm. It’s crucial to approach these games with a responsible mindset and prioritize safe gaming practices. Setting clear limits on both time and money spent is paramount. Players should only gamble with disposable income that they can afford to lose without impacting their daily lives or financial obligations.

Recognizing the signs of problem gambling is also vital. These signs include spending increasing amounts of time and money on the game, neglecting personal responsibilities, and experiencing feelings of guilt or shame. If you or someone you know is struggling with a gambling addiction, seeking help from a qualified professional is essential. Here are some guidelines for maintaining responsible gaming habits:

  1. Set a Time Limit: Decide how long you’ll play before starting.
  2. Establish a Loss Limit: Know when to quit if you’re losing.
  3. Avoid Chasing Losses: Don’t try to win back lost money.
  4. Take Regular Breaks: Step away from the game periodically.
  5. Gamble for Entertainment: View it as a fun activity, not a source of income.
